掌桥专利:专业的专利平台
掌桥专利
首页

一种振幅、相位信息可调节的全波形反演方法及装置

文献发布时间:2023-06-19 11:40:48


一种振幅、相位信息可调节的全波形反演方法及装置

技术领域

本发明涉及一种振幅、相位信息可调节的全波形反演方法及装置,属于地震勘探速度建模技术领域。

背景技术

随着我国石油勘探向深层及超深层转移,深部目标层高陡复杂构造的高精度成像问题已成为当前制约我国石油勘探和开发迫在眉睫的瓶颈。速度建模是实现复杂构造成像的灵魂,而诸如速度层析反演等传统速度建模技术虽在过去的数十年中取得了巨大的成功,但已无法满足高分辨率地震成像的需求。因此,亟需发展新一代速度建模技术,以满足复杂构造成像的需求。

目前,全波形反演(Full Waveform Inversion,FWI)是公认的最具潜力的新一代速度建模技术,在准确的初始模型下能够恢复出高分辨率的速度模型,可用于提高深层目标层偏移成像的质量,具有广阔的应用前景和潜在的经济效益。全波形反演以层析反演或者速度分析结果为初始模型,可实现高分辨率的速度建模,结合保幅的偏移成像方法,获得高质量的成像剖面,为地质解释提供支撑和依据,因此全波形反演成为近些年来的研究热点之一。然而,计算效率低下是制约全波形反演进行大规模计算以及实际资料处理的主要因素,现有的一种解决方法是使用震源编码策略,其思想是通过某种震源组合方式将很多单炮形成一个超级震源,从而减少波场模拟的次数。其中被广泛应用的一种为基于频率选择的同时源全波形反演方法,它可以获得无串扰的反演结果,但是这种方法如果在初始模型不是很理想时,由于波场振幅信息对初始模型比较敏感,使用全波场信息匹配很容易使得全波形反演陷入局部极小值,所以开展数据子集或者波场属性反演就显得十分需要。由于振幅信息对初始模型的敏感度比相位信息高,所以当初始模型不准确时,直接使用全波形反演,可能导致全波形反演低波数更新不准确,从而导致高波数更新的界面位置不对,降低反演的精度。

因此,如何提供一种新的同时源反演方法,能够克服现有技术存在的反演精度低的问题是本领域技术人员亟需解决的技术难题。

发明内容

针对上述现有技术存在的问题,本发明提供一种振幅、相位信息可调节的全波形反演方法及装置,通过一系列单频子波同时激发形成混叠波场;并采用相敏检测法从混叠波场中解耦出每一个编码信号对应的波场变量,实现无串扰的梯度计算,从而有效提高反演精度。

为了实现上述目的,本发明采用的技术方案是:一种振幅、相位信息可调节的全波形反演方法,具体步骤为:

A、通过多个位于不同位置的单频子波同时激发作为震源,采用多个检波点组成观测系统,通过观测系统获得观测数据;建立速度场模型(该速度场模型从现有模型中选择一个),并根据震源情况计算得出模拟数据;

B、基于观测数据和模拟数据,构建表征所述观测数据与所述模拟数据之间数据残差的目标函数;

C、根据震源与检波点之间的位置,得出虚拟震源的信息,然后根据观测数据获取震源的正传波场;并根据目标函数获得虚拟震源的反传波场;

D、确定目标函数关于速度场模型参数的梯度计算表达式,在不同的反演阶段具有两种计算表达式,其中在反演初期即低频反演阶段,采用具有相位信息反演的梯度表达式,在反演的中后阶段,采用兼顾波场相位和振幅信息的全波形反演的梯度表达式;先对震源的正传波场和虚拟震源的反传波场分别进行无串扰解耦,获得解耦的波场变量;然后根据得到的波场变量和梯度计算表达式,计算得到速度场模型参数的梯度;反演初期和反演中后期具体划分为:多尺度全波形反演一般反演3至5个频带,通常前一到两个频带被认为是低波数恢复,也就是低频反演阶段,中间频带的反演恢复中波数信息,后续频带为高频反演。

E、采用共轭梯度方法求取更新方向,根据得到的梯度对速度场模型参数进行迭代更新,直至数据残差达到设定阈值或迭代更新次数达到预设值,停止迭代更新确定速度场模型参数,此时采用该参数的速度场模型进行全波形反演。

进一步,所述步骤B中的目标函数采用最小化位于检波点X

其中,x表示计算区域,m(x)表示计算区域x处的速度场模型参数;X

进一步,所述步骤A中的震源为同时源模拟波场:

给定一系列位于X

其中,X

进一步,所述步骤C中震源的正传波场由求解模拟方程得到,具体模拟方程为:

其中,

震源对应的虚拟震源为:

根据确定的虚拟震源,获取伴随方程,所述伴随方程为:

其中,

求解伴随方程,获得虚拟震源的反传波场。

进一步,所述步骤D中无串扰解耦具体为:

采用相敏检测法先获取第一参考信号和第二参考信号,所述第一参考信号的振幅和频率均与所述第二参考信号的振幅和频率相同,所述第一参考信号的相位与所述第二参考信号的相位相差90°;然后根据第一参考信号和第二参考信号,采用三角函数正交性对震源的正传波场和虚拟震源的反传波场分别进行无串扰解耦。

一种振幅、相位信息可调节的全波形反演装置,包括:

目标函数构建模块,用于基于观测数据和模拟数据,构建表征所述观测数据与所述模拟数据之间数据残差的目标函数;

正传波场获取模块,用于获取震源的正传波场;

反传波场获取模块,用于获取虚拟震源的反传波场;

梯度计算模块,用于根据正传波场、反传波场和目标函数关于速度场模型参数的相位反演、全波场反演梯度计算表达式,计算速度场模型参数的梯度;

迭代更新模块,用于根据计算获得的梯度对当前速度场模型参数进行迭代更新,直至所述数据残差达到设定阈值或者迭代更新次数达到预设值,确定速度场模型参数。

与现有技术相比,本发明采用一系列单频子波同时激发形成混叠波场;并采用了相敏检测法从混叠波场中解耦出每一个编码信号对应的波场变量,实现了无串扰的梯度计算,从而有利于获得准确的速度场模型参数的更新方向。另外在目标函数关于速度场模型参数的梯度计算表达式计算中,采用在不同的反演阶段使用不同的计算表达式,即在反演初期(即低频反演阶段)主要以相位信息反演为主,在反演的中后阶段,采用全波形反演,可以减弱反演对初始模型的依赖性。

综上,本发明通过多个单频编码信号同时激发实现同时源模拟;采用一阶速度—应力声波动方程,在一次正演模拟中完成多个震源子波的波场模拟,通过相敏检测方法分别对正传和反传波场实施波场解耦计算,求取无串扰的梯度结果,通过使用相位反演和全波形反演相结合的策略,可以降低目标函数的复杂度,从而减少反演中的多解性,实现高精度的反演。

附图说明

图1是本发明实施例的步骤示意图;

图2是Overthrust模型下真实速度场模型参数和初始速度场模型参数的示意图;

其中,图2a为真实的速度模型,图2b为反演所用的初始速度模型;

图3是本发明中采用相敏检测方法对反传源波场进行解耦得到的其对应的解耦波场的振幅和相位信息;

其中,图3a表示解耦波场的振幅信息,图3b表示解耦波场的相位信息;

图4是本发明实施例运用到Overthrust模型得到的反演结果与常规方法得到的反演结果的对比示意图;

其中,图4a是仅使用波场振幅信息的同时源反演结果;图4b是仅使用波场相位信息的同时源反演结果;图4c是同时使用波场振幅信息的同时源反演结果,即全波形反演方法;图4d是采用本发明实施例得到的结果;

图5是本发明实施例运用到Overthrust模型中得到的反演的目标函数下降曲线对比示意图。

具体实施方式

下面将结合本文实施例中的附图,对本文实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本文一部分实施例,而不是全部的实施例。基于本文中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本文保护的范围。

如图1所示,本发明实施例的反演方法,包括:

S1:通过多个位于不同位置的单频子波同时激发作为震源,采用多个检波点组成观测系统,通过观测系统获得观测数据;建立已知的速度场模型(采用Overthrust模型),并根据震源情况计算得出模拟数据;

S2:建立表征观测数据与模拟数据之间数据残差的目标函数;

所述目标函数采用最小化位于检波点X

其中,x表示计算区域,m(x)表示计算区域x处的速度场模型参数;X

S3:根据震源与检波点之间的位置,得出虚拟震源的信息,然后根据观测数据获取震源的正传波场;并根据目标函数获得虚拟震源的反传波场;

给定一系列位于X

其中,X

则震源

其中,

相应地,伴随方程为:

式(4)中,

式(5)中,

通常情况下,由于观测数据和模拟数据的观测系统不一致,所以需要分别从观测和模拟数据对应的单个信号数据中提取相同频率的信号,在观测数据的观测系统约束下求取数据的残差,以此解决观测系统不一致的问题。

S4:使用正传波场和反传波场进行梯度计算,迭代计算目标函数数据残差以更新速度场模型参数:

具体地,包括如下步骤:

S41:获得目标函数对速度场模型参数的梯度计算表达式;

S42:根据同时源模拟进行正演和反传计算,获得解耦的波场变量;

本实施例中,梯度计算表达式为正传波场与反传波场的特定形式的互相关,可简写为:

梯度简写形式G(x,m)表达式中,ψ

由(6)式可知,只有从混叠的波场中解耦出所有编码信号的波场,然后只计算当前编码信号对应的正反传波场的自相关,才能从根本上消除串扰噪声。

即,有效地解耦混叠波场是解决串扰噪声的关键,本实施例引入相敏检测(PSD)法来解决这个问题。PSD的主要思想是:利用两个与未知信号具有相同频率但彼此相位相差90°的参考信号进行时间积分来提取振幅为sin(ω

本实施例中,取E

由于空间某一点的混叠波场,均可以表示为:

其中,

使|ω

在积分区间qT

T

以及,将所述第二参考信号与所述混叠波场的信号相乘并积分,得到:

从而,与第一参考信号和第二参考信号频率相同的编码信号的对应波场便能解耦出来,其计算公式为:

上述积分过程主要利用了三角函数正交性,只有与第一参考信号和第二参考信号频率相同的信号其得到积分结果不为零,其他与第一参考信号和第二参考信号频率不同的信号其得到的积分结果为零,从而实现对空间中任意一混叠波场中各频率编码信号其对应波场的解耦。

S43:利用目标函数对速度场模型参数的梯度计算表达式和解耦的波场变量,获取模型参数梯度;

其中速度模型的梯度计算式为:

其中,Re表示取向量的实数部分;u(x,ω

本实施例采用五个频带的多尺度反演,在前两个频带反演(即反演的初始阶段),采用具有相位信息反演的梯度表达式,在后面三个频带反演(即反演的中后阶段),采用兼顾波场相位和振幅信息的全波形反演的梯度表达式。

基于上述梯度表达式,拓展出具有相位信息反演的梯度表达式为:

其中,

与之对应的兼顾波场相位和振幅信息的全波形反演的梯度表达式为

其中

S5:采用共轭梯度方法求取更新方向,对模型参数梯度进行迭代更新,直至残差达到设定值或者迭代更新次数达到预设值,停止迭代更新输出速度场模型参数,此时采用该参数的速度场模型进行全波形反演。

采用共轭梯度方法求取更新方向Δm

式(14)中的下标k表示迭代次数,s

m

即将式(14)中计算得到的Δm

上述反演方法所需的反演装置,包括:

目标函数构建模块,用于基于观测数据和模拟数据,构建表征所述观测数据与所述模拟数据之间数据残差的目标函数;

正传波场获取模块,用于获取震源的正传波场;

反传波场获取模块,用于获取虚拟震源的反传波场;

梯度计算模块,用于根据正传波场、反传波场和目标函数关于速度场模型参数的相位反演、全波场反演梯度计算表达式,计算速度场模型参数的梯度;

迭代更新模块,用于根据计算获得的梯度对当前速度场模型参数进行迭代更新,直至所述数据残差达到设定阈值或者迭代更新次数达到预设值,确定速度场模型参数。

效果验证:

将本发明实施例运用到Overthrust模型得到的反演结果与常规方法得到的反演结果进行对比;由图4b与图4a对比,能看出相位反演相对于振幅反演的精度更高,说明相位反演对初始模型的依赖性较小,可以恢复出有效的低波数信息;图4c与图4d相比,可以看出,采用本发明实施例全波形反演方法其结果比常规反演在界面的清晰度,高波数的连续性等方面更好。

如图5所示,采用本发明实施例的全波形反演方法与常规方法对应的目标函数下降曲线对比,由图可知,相比于其他几种反演方法,振幅反演的目标函数在低频下降缓慢,这说明振幅反演过早陷入局部极值;虽然同时使用相位和振幅的全波形反演在低频有着最大的下降率,但是随着迭代次数的增加,其目标函数的下降曲线逐渐与相位反演相一致;对于本发明实施例的方案,在开始阶段与相位反演吻合度很高,随着迭代次数的增加,其目标函数值逐渐低于相位反演,直至最后的频带、组合反演的目标函数值是四种反演算法中最低的,这说明本发明实施例的反演方法可以降低目标函数的复杂度,使得目标函数下降的更多。

相关技术
  • 一种振幅、相位信息可调节的全波形反演方法及装置
  • 电磁波相位振幅生成装置、电磁波相位振幅生成方法以及电磁波相位振幅生成程序
技术分类

06120113009293